## Runbook: Cron migration to Weavework

Each legacy cron entry must be recreated as a Weavework workflow with an explicit timezone and overlap policy; the old crontab assumed UTC and silently skipped overlapping runs. Verify the schedule string in staging before promoting. Disable the crontab line only after two successful workflow runs. The engine connects using the settings below.

deployment values, kagef-hahap:
wenael:
  log_level: warn
  metrics_host: metrics.wenael.qorvelsys.internal
  pin: 3768
  pool_size: 32

Security note: rules are
// loaded at boot from a signed bundle; this constant is the fallback used
// only when signature verification fails closed. No user input reaches the
// evaluator before normalization in rate_guard.go. Review the surcharge
// caps below carefully — they bound worst-case fee output and prevent the
// negative-fee bypass fixed last quarter. Changing any cap requires a
// second reviewer from the payments group. The bundle this fallback was
// generated from is identified by the token below.

build token for tawip-yageg: htk9_92ac43d42

// Reviewer note: this caps the batch size for the Pellam loader that
// fixed our GraphQL N+1 mess. Before this, every `author` field fired
// its own query — brutal on the Tidewell dashboard. DataLoader batches
// now collapse those into one round trip. Verified against the staging
// build; token for that run follows.

session token of fahap-hawip = htk31_7852f2b3276dba2738f98fa97f92237

MEMO — Kettling Depot Receiving

Uniform sets for the new Kettling depot arrive Wednesday via Ashgrove courier: 40 boxes, sorted by size, manifest attached to box one. Check the count at the dock before signing; shortages go straight to stores, not the courier. The hand-over instruction the courier will follow is set out below.

drop instructions, tafof-baguf: the holmir gilox courier leaves the sormir ulaok holdor ledger at gate 5596 under passcode 257343